Engineering is one of the most popular streams of education in India. It includes various disciplines like Computer Science Engineering, Electronics and Communication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, and Civil Engineering, among others. Engineering graduates have a wide range of career opportunities available to them in different industries like IT, manufacturing, construction, and more.

Here's a breakdown of some of the most popular engineering disciplines in India:

  • Computer Science Engineering (CSE): Computer Science Engineering is a highly sought-after engineering discipline in India. It includes the study of computer programming, algorithms, data structures, computer architecture, and more. Graduates with a degree in CSE can pursue careers in software development, database administration, cybersecurity, and more.

  • Electronics and Communication Engineering (ECE): Electronics and Communication Engineering is another popular engineering discipline in India. It includes the study of electronic devices, circuits, communication systems, and more. Graduates with a degree in ECE can pursue careers in telecommunications, signal processing, embedded systems, and more.

  • Mechanical Engineering: Mechanical Engineering is a broad engineering discipline that includes the study of mechanics, thermodynamics, robotics, and more. Graduates with a degree in Mechanical Engineering can pursue careers in manufacturing, automotive engineering, energy management, and more.

  • Electrical Engineering: Electrical Engineering is another popular engineering discipline in India. It includes the study of electrical circuits, power systems, control systems, and more. Graduates with a degree in Electrical Engineering can pursue careers in power generation, transmission and distribution, automation, and more.

  • Civil Engineering: Civil Engineering is a challenging engineering discipline that includes the study of construction, transportation, environmental engineering, and more. Graduates with a degree in Civil Engineering can pursue careers in construction, infrastructure development, and environmental conservation, among other fields.
